- [ ] Step 7: Archive cold storage buckets (Glacierline tier). Confirm both ceremony witnesses are present, verify bucket manifests match the Oxbow ledger, then seal the archive key shares. Plugin authors may observe but not handle shares. Once sealed, the archive index itself is encrypted and can only be reopened with the passphrase below.

vault phrase of badup-hahig = tamael-aldael-kelmir-istael-fenok-istwyn-tamius-jorath-oliion

## Migration Step 4: Canary Gating Rules

Canary deploys on Hollowgate now gate on error rate, p99 latency, and saturation. If any metric breaches for five minutes, rollout halts automatically and support sees a halted badge in the console. Do not manually resume; file an escalation instead. Gating thresholds live in the rules table of the deploy database. To check current thresholds when a customer asks, connect using the string below.

primary connection of tajeg-tajop = postgresql://julax_svc:DI@db-e7f3.kelvidyn.corp:5432/rusdor

Before promoting the Thornfield release, regenerate the static-analysis baseline with the lint-freeze task and confirm no new suppressions were added since the last cut. Commit the baseline file to the release branch only, with a note in the changelog. Signing of the baseline archive requires the key that follows this paragraph.

rollout seal: bky4_x7Gc

## Account Recovery — LintDock

Scope: restoring admin access to LintDock, the documentation linter service.

1. Confirm requester identity via two teammates on the Quillford roster.
2. Disable SSO binding for the locked account.
3. Boot LintDock in recovery mode; rule packs stay read-only.
4. Re-run baseline lint pass to confirm index integrity.
5. Rotate the recovery material immediately after use and log the event.

The current recovery passphrase for the admin keystore is listed directly below this line.

vault phrase of hagug-fawif = istmir-novvan-ulaeth-lamix